Education information

Great Britain is considered the birthplace of modern football, and here it is not just a sports game - it is a national treasure and a deep part of English culture. This is evidenced by the fact that every British school has a football section, and in every locality in England there is always an adult and children's team. The UK is also famous for its football clubs, which are considered the most successful in the world.

One of these clubs is the Manchester United club, based in the city of the same name. Many people call Manchester the paradise of world football, as it is not only the second largest stadium in the UK, Old Trafford, but also a football museum. Another football club, Manchester City, is also based here.

In addition to football, Manchester is famous for its scientific, technical and industrial achievements - for example:

  • creation of the first programmable computer,
  • opening of the first passenger railway station,
  • The University of Manchester has produced more than 20 future Nobel laureates.

The city attracts not only tourists and football fans, but also schoolchildren who want to get a high-quality education and plunge deeper into their favorite sport.
